We have a current opening for a Project Manager in Dallas, TX.

The Project Manager will support projects for the Building Group; Multifamily, Commercial, etc.

Success in the position is achieved through the following duties & responsibilities :

  • Build and maintain relationship with General Contractors and / or Project Owners, Subcontractors and vendors that promote project success.
  • Be the point person from the preconstruction phase to the project closeout phase.
  • Properly delegate tasks and responsibilities to appropriate team members and ensure entire project team thoroughly understands project.
  • Facilitate coordination between Field Operations and Preconstruction (preplanning, prefabrication) and actively engage in implementation of project plan.
  • Review construction documents for inconsistencies and develop RFIs.
  • Perform detailed estimates of revised construction documents and provide clarifications with clear and concise inclusions / exclusions.
  • Review and interpret specifications to understand project requirements, coordinate discrepancies with contract documents, redline and / or provide cost for items outside of basis of design-on-design build / design assist projects.
  • Create subcontracts while working towards buyout from estimate; include subcontract terms and conditions that limit company risk and clearly identify project scope inclusions and exclusions to set project expectations.
  • Partner with Contracts to review and interpret contract language, confirm contract scope inclusions and exclusions are conducive to proposal letter, determine timelines for required notices / rights / remedies, and ensure milestones in base bid schedule are achievable as depicted.
  • Early identification of long lead items; ensure all project procurement is properly tracked and released conducive to schedule milestones.
  • Setup project budget with assistance from Estimating to work towards buyouts and early recognition of actual realized costs in labor, material, subcontractor, equipment, and overhead cost.
  • Understand the difference between lump sum contracts and unit price contracts.
  • Verify budget after upload confirming contract, budget, and billing are accurate in Spectrum.
  • Determine project labor tracking strategy and setup labor codes congruent with required labor tracking.
  • Gather hours from Superintendent and Foreman and verify with project team.
  • Monitor and own the overall procurement and construction schedule and escalate any possible impacts by coordinating with the customer, giving notice as required and maintain documentation for such impacts.
  • Collect feedback from field team to present accurate information for CTCs.
  • Create projection for CTCs and provide to Project Executive for review.
  • Prepare accurate cost projections for each project monthly. Stay actively engaged with labor tracking and weekly look ahead schedules to mitigate any potential impacts to the project schedule or financial status.
  • Oversee timely project requirements and documentation including but not limited to submittals, RFI’s, delay notices, potential claims, and extended overheads.
  • Maximize cash flow by balancing project cost with timing of project income, facilitating buy outs according to the schedule and project plan with estimating and project teams, understanding labor and material trends, creating balanced and accurate budget and Schedule of Values, submitting billings, and negotiating change orders.
  • Proactively assist subcontractors with billings, change orders and negotiations
  • Coach Project Engineers and Sr Project Engineers for successful accomplishment of their own key results
